天翼云对象存储数据持久性,天翼云对象存储bucket的名称全局可以有多个
- 综合资讯
- 2024-10-02 04:57:48
- 4

***:天翼云对象存储具有数据持久性的特点,其bucket(存储桶)在名称方面全局可存在多个。这一特性在天翼云对象存储体系中有重要意义,数据持久性保障了存储数据的稳定可...
***:天翼云对象存储具有数据持久性的特点。其bucket(存储桶)在名称方面,全局可存在多个。这体现了天翼云对象存储在存储管理上的特性,数据持久性为用户数据存储提供了可靠保障,而多个可命名的bucket有助于用户进行数据的分类存储与管理等操作,从不同方面反映出天翼云对象存储在满足用户存储需求方面的相关特性。
《天翼云对象存储:Bucket名称全局多性下的数据持久性深度剖析》
一、引言
在当今数字化时代,数据存储的需求日益增长且变得更加复杂,天翼云对象存储作为一种重要的云存储解决方案,以其独特的特性满足了众多用户在数据存储、管理和保护方面的需求,bucket(存储桶)作为对象存储中的基本容器概念,其名称全局可以有多个这一特性对数据持久性有着多方面的影响,值得深入探讨。
二、天翼云对象存储概述
(一)天翼云对象存储的基本架构
天翼云对象存储采用分布式架构,将数据分散存储在多个节点上,这种架构能够有效地提高数据的可用性和可靠性,对象存储中的对象是存储的基本单元,它包含数据本身、元数据(如对象的创建时间、大小等信息)以及唯一标识符。
(二)对象存储与传统存储的区别
与传统的块存储和文件存储不同,对象存储不依赖于特定的文件系统结构或块设备的寻址方式,对象存储以扁平的结构存储对象,通过HTTP等标准协议进行数据访问,这使得它在处理大规模、非结构化数据(如图片、视频、文档等)方面具有天然的优势。
三、Bucket名称全局可多个的意义与特性
(一)命名的灵活性
1、业务区分
在实际应用中,不同的业务部门或项目可能需要独立的存储空间来管理数据,一家大型企业可能有电商业务、物流业务和客户服务业务等,通过允许在全局有多个bucket名称,可以为每个业务创建专属的bucket,如“e - commerce - data - bucket”“logistics - data - bucket”和“customer - service - data - bucket”,这样可以方便地根据业务名称对数据进行分类存储,提高数据管理的效率。
2、数据隔离
多个bucket名称也有助于实现数据隔离,对于一些有安全要求或者合规性需求的场景,不同类型的数据(如敏感的用户信息和普通的运营数据)可以存放在不同名称的bucket中,即使在同一个天翼云对象存储账户下,也能通过bucket的名称区分来确保数据的安全性和独立性。
(二)资源管理的便利性
1、配额分配
天翼云平台可以针对不同名称的bucket进行配额分配,对于重要但数据量较小的业务bucket,可以分配较小的存储配额,而对于数据增长迅速的业务bucket,可以给予较大的配额,这种基于bucket名称的资源管理方式,能够更加精细地控制资源的使用,提高资源利用率。
2、访问控制
可以根据bucket名称设置不同的访问权限,某些bucket可能只允许内部特定的用户组访问,而其他bucket可以对外公开部分数据,通过在全局设置多个具有不同访问权限的bucket名称,能够满足多样化的业务需求,确保数据在合适的范围内被访问。
四、数据持久性与Bucket名称的关联
(一)数据冗余与多bucket
1、多bucket下的数据副本策略
天翼云对象存储为了保证数据持久性,会采用数据冗余的方式,当有多个bucket名称存在时,可以针对不同的bucket设置不同的数据副本策略,对于核心业务数据的bucket,可以设置较高的副本数量,确保在某个节点或区域出现故障时,数据能够迅速从其他副本恢复,而对于一些临时性或非关键数据的bucket,可以适当降低副本数量,以节省存储资源。
2、跨bucket的数据备份
不同名称的bucket还可以用于数据备份的目的,可以将生产环境中的数据bucket定期备份到专门用于备份的bucket中,这种跨bucket的备份方式不仅增加了数据的安全性,而且在数据恢复时提供了更多的选择,如果生产环境中的数据由于误操作或恶意攻击而损坏,可以从备份bucket中恢复数据,而不会影响生产环境中正常业务的运行。
(二)数据一致性维护
1、多bucket数据更新的一致性
在多bucket的环境下,当数据发生更新时,需要确保数据的一致性,一个企业可能在多个地区有业务,每个地区的数据存放在不同名称的bucket中,当企业的产品信息发生更新时,需要将更新后的产品信息同步到各个地区对应的bucket中,天翼云对象存储通过内部的一致性协议和数据同步机制,保证在多bucket环境下数据的一致性,从而维持数据的持久性。
2、版本控制与多bucket
版本控制是保证数据持久性的重要手段,在多个bucket存在的情况下,可以针对每个bucket设置不同的版本控制策略,对于一些需要严格审计和数据追溯的业务bucket,可以开启详细的版本控制,记录每个对象的所有版本信息,而对于一些对版本要求不高的bucket,可以简化版本控制,以提高数据操作的效率。
五、影响数据持久性的其他因素与多bucket的协同作用
(一)存储介质与多bucket
1、不同存储介质下的bucket优化
天翼云对象存储可能会采用多种存储介质,如硬盘、固态硬盘、磁带等,不同名称的bucket可以根据数据的特性和业务需求选择合适的存储介质,对于频繁访问的热数据bucket,可以选择固态硬盘作为存储介质,以提高数据的读写速度;而对于不经常访问的冷数据bucket,可以使用磁带等低成本的存储介质,这种根据bucket名称对存储介质的优化选择,有助于在保证数据持久性的同时,降低存储成本。
2、存储介质故障与多bucket恢复
当存储介质发生故障时,多bucket的结构能够提供更多的恢复途径,如果某个存储介质上的bucket数据损坏,由于数据可能在其他bucket中有副本或者备份,就可以从其他正常的bucket中恢复数据,天翼云的存储系统会自动检测存储介质的故障,并根据预先设置的策略将数据从故障介质上的bucket迁移到其他正常的介质上的bucket,确保数据的持久性。
(二)网络因素与多bucket
1、网络分区与多bucket数据访问
在网络出现分区的情况下,多bucket的设置可以提高数据的可访问性,在不同的数据中心可能有不同名称的bucket,当某个数据中心的网络出现故障时,可以通过其他数据中心的bucket继续访问相关数据,天翼云对象存储通过分布式的网络架构和智能的路由算法,确保在网络异常情况下,多bucket中的数据能够尽可能地被正常访问,维持数据的持久性。
2、网络带宽与多bucket数据传输
不同名称的bucket可以根据网络带宽的实际情况进行数据传输的优化,对于网络带宽较窄的bucket,可以限制数据传输的频率和大小,以避免网络拥塞影响数据的持久性,而对于网络带宽充足的bucket,可以提高数据传输的效率,加快数据的备份、恢复等操作。
六、多bucket环境下数据持久性的管理与最佳实践
(一)监控与预警
1、多bucket数据状态监控
在天翼云对象存储中,需要对多个bucket的数据状态进行实时监控,包括数据的存储量、数据的访问频率、数据的完整性等方面,通过监控工具,可以及时发现数据的异常变化,如某个bucket的数据量突然异常增加或减少,可能意味着数据出现了误操作或安全问题。
2、持久性指标预警
针对数据持久性相关的指标,如数据副本的数量、存储介质的健康状态等,设置预警机制,当这些指标达到临界值时,及时向管理员发出预警,以便采取相应的措施,如增加数据副本、修复存储介质故障等,确保数据持久性不受影响。
(二)数据迁移与整合
1、多bucket间的数据迁移策略
随着业务的发展,可能需要对不同名称的bucket进行数据迁移,当业务合并或者数据的分类方式发生改变时,在进行数据迁移时,需要制定详细的迁移策略,确保数据在迁移过程中的完整性和持久性,可以采用增量迁移的方式,先迁移未被修改的数据,再迁移更新的数据,同时在迁移过程中进行数据校验,保证数据的准确性。
2、数据整合与多bucket优化
定期对多个bucket的数据进行整合优化也是提高数据持久性的重要手段,可以将一些功能相似或者数据关联性强的bucket进行合并,减少数据的冗余存储,提高存储资源的利用率,在整合过程中,可以重新评估数据的副本策略、访问权限等,以更好地适应业务发展的需求。
(三)安全与合规性管理
1、多bucket下的安全策略
在多bucket环境下,需要制定全面的安全策略,包括对每个bucket的访问控制、数据加密等方面,对于存储敏感数据的bucket,要采用高强度的加密算法对数据进行加密,并且严格限制访问权限,只有经过授权的用户才能进行解密和访问操作。
2、合规性要求与多bucket
不同的行业和地区可能有不同的合规性要求,医疗行业需要遵守严格的患者数据保护法规,金融行业需要满足数据安全和隐私的相关规定,在多bucket环境下,要确保每个bucket的数据存储和管理都符合相应的合规性要求,这也是保证数据持久性的重要方面。
七、结论
天翼云对象存储中bucket名称全局可以有多个这一特性为数据持久性提供了多方面的支持,通过灵活的命名、资源管理、数据冗余、一致性维护等功能,以及与存储介质、网络因素等的协同作用,在多bucket环境下能够有效地提高数据的可用性、可靠性和安全性,通过合理的管理与最佳实践,如监控预警、数据迁移整合和安全合规管理等,可以进一步确保数据在复杂的云计算环境下的持久性,随着企业数字化转型的不断深入和数据量的持续增长,深入理解和利用天翼云对象存储的多bucket特性对于保障数据的长期保存和有效利用具有至关重要的意义。
本文链接:https://www.zhitaoyun.cn/122362.html
发表评论